Importing Data

You can load a saved session by selecting its name from the File menu.

To import a single data set directly from the MATLAB workspace, do one of the following:

  1. To create a data set from input and output signals available in the workspace, select
    Import data->Time domain data
    or Import data->Frequency domain data
    from the pop-up menu in the System Identification app's main window.
  2. If the data set already exists in the workspace as an IDDATA or IDFRD object, then import it by selecting
    Import data->Data Object
Note: Use the hot-key d to open the Import Data dialog when the window is in focus.

In the Import Data dialog box, enter the appropriate information, such as the Starting time and the Sample time. Click the More button to display additional fields in the dialog, such as for entering Notes.

Work Sessions

Work Sessions

A saved session stores the status of the data sets and models that are currently in the Model and Data Board(s) - including their diary and notes. The session also includes an arbitrary number of additional boards (opened by selecting Options->Extra model/data board in the System Identification app window).

You open, manage, save and close sessions by selecting commands from the File menu in the window.

Only one session can be open at any time. You can, however, merge a previously-saved session into the current one by selecting File->Merge session from the menu.
